Larger Diameter Tubing From Base to Tip

At the core of the Pro Series is a re-engineered aluminum tube system featuring increased diameters in every section—from the base tube through the midsection and all the way to the tip. By enlarging the entire structural profile, the outrigger achieves:

  • Substantially greater stiffness under load

  • Reduced flex and vibration at extended layout angles

  • Improved spread stability in challenging offshore conditions

  • Enhanced lure performance at higher trolling speeds

This full-length diameter expansion yields the most stable, most rigid aluminum outrigger platform Rupp has ever produced.


Advanced PRO LEVEL Hydraulic Integration for Large Sportfishing Boats

The Pro Series pairs seamlessly with Rupp’s new Gen2 Pro Series hydraulic system, building on the proven architecture of our Gen2 systems. Key features such as AutoDeploy™, wireless remote capability, and our patented hydraulic locking mechanism remain central to the design.

Pro Series Hydraulics = Simultaneous Deployment & Retrieval

A major functional advancement is the ability to deploy or retrieve both outriggers simultaneously, giving captains:

  • Faster spread setup and retrieval

  • More efficient bridge clearance maneuvers

  • Improved operational flow during tournament conditions

  • A smoother, more intuitive helm experience

For boat builders, the hydraulic system is engineered for clean, repeatable installation with consistent routing, fewer variables, and simplified integration across multiple models.


Upgraded Heavy-Duty Cables & Interface Points

To support the increased stiffness and size of the new Pro Series poles, the cable system has been upgraded with higher-strength materials and refined interface geometry. These enhancements deliver:

  • Increased durability under sustained offshore loads

  • Smoother deployment and retrieval

  • Stronger attachment points for long-term reliability

  • Improved performance with modern dredge and teaser programs

Each component is engineered to operate as part of a cohesive, high-capacity outrigger system.
